FIFA Announces 2014 Brazil World Cup Venues
FIFA has officially announced the 12 venues for the 2014 World Cup in Brazil (see FIFA news). Yesterday, after a weekend-long gathering in Nassau, Bahamas, the final list was revealed, confirming Brazil's major cities as hosts.

Long before the list of venues was confirmed, Agência Brasil, the national news agency, reported on a study carried out by Sinaenco, the National Architecture and Engineering Syndicate, pointing out what the hopefuls would need to do to improve their stadiums.
